  6. Rite so im bleeding my magura hs33 for the first time, Im using water, and ive done exactly what people have told me to do, but when i press the lever (after finishing the bleed and screwing everything back on) its like theres no fluid in there at all, the pads just stay still.

    Ive not actualy got the brake attached to the bike at the minute, could this be affecting it ?

    This is what i am doing ...

    im filling my syringe with water, i am then attaching to my pipe (that has the bit you screw into the brake init)

    Im then undoing the screw on the brake and screwing the screw in the pipe into the brake,

    Im then completely un screwing the other bleed screw on the leaver

    Im then pushing the syringe slowly untill almost all the water has left and just letting the water drip out of the leaver,

    Im then taking all the syringe and pipe ect. off and screwing the screw back into the brake, and then the same with the screw on the leaver.
